Grated Potato Tzimmes Recipe
Ingredients
| Unsweetened prunes - 1 pound | ||
| Water | 3 Cup (16 tbs) | |
| Potatoes | 8 | |
| Brown sugar | 1/3 Cup (16 tbs) | |
| Lemon juice | 2 Tablespoon | |
| Salt | 1 1/2 Teaspoon | |
| Potato flour | 3 Tablespoon | |
| Fat | 2 Tablespoon, melted | |
| Pepper | 1/8 Teaspoon | |
Directions
GETTING READY
1. Wash prunes. Soak it in water for 1 hour.
2. Slice potatoes.
MAKING
3. In a saucepan, bring prunes to a boil.
4. In a 2-quart casserole, add potatoes and pour undrained prunes over it.
5. Add brown sugar, lemon juice and 1 teaspoon of salt.
6. Cover and bake it in an oven at 350°F for 1 hour.
7. Take the remaining potatoes and grate it.
8. In a bowl, add potato flour, fat, pepper, remaining salt and grated potatoes.
9. Spread this mixture over the contents of baked casserole.
10. Cover and bake for additional 1 1/4 hours. Remove cover during the last 45 minutes of cooking.
SERVING
11. Serve Grated Potato Tzimmes immediately.
